Jaylen Brown, Kristaps Porzingis among Celtics players ready to take on rival Knicks: 'It's going to be a war'
- The Boston Celtics will begin their second-round 2025 NBA Eastern Conference playoff series against the New York Knicks starting Monday in Boston.
- This matchup arises from the Celtics' dominant regular season and the Knicks' offseason acquisitions of Karl-Anthony Towns and Mikal Bridges to improve postseason chances.
- Key Celtics players Jaylen Brown and Jayson Tatum lead a deep rotation potentially strengthened by Jrue Holiday’s likely return, while Porzingis, who averages 24.5 points against the Knicks, must improve defensively.
- The Celtics swept the Knicks 4-0 during the regular season by 65 combined points, and betting odds heavily favor Boston with a money line of-800 on BetMGM.
- The series outcome remains uncertain, as the Celtics seek a fourth straight conference finals appearance while the Knicks aim to break a 25-year absence from that stage.

The Knicks advance and will face a tough test against the defending champion Celtics in the second round of the playoffs.
By LARRY LAGE DETROIT (AP) — The New York Knicks made some significant moves to bolster their roster, adding Karl-Anthony Towns and Mikal Bridges in hopes of competing for an NBA championship. They're about to find out if they have what it takes. New York beat the Detroit Pistons 116-113 in Game 6 of their first-round series and now face the Boston Celtics.
